The study of scientific and technological potential is an important task in determining the technological leadership of countries. There is no universal indicator for its assessment, it is common to consider a set of indirect indicators for the implementation of such studies. The paper considers the tool for assessing the S&T landscape of countries on the example of Japan and the Republic of Korea, as well as the visualization of the results, which allows to present large amounts of data in an easy-to-understand format. The paper analyzes existing methodologies for assessing the S&T landscape, including the methodology for assessing the potential for modernization of the industrial complex, technological forecasting and social change through the citation network and topic analysis, patent landscape. The collection and processing of scientific publications of the selected countries of 1,803,000 by means of software tools are considered, and a data repository is compiled. A tool for assessing the S&T landscape is presented, including its visualization in the form of a 3D graph at the scale of the scientific field and the country as a whole.
